Monitoring of brain activity.
Instantaneous insights.
The capacity of these biosensor-equipped earphones to track brain activity is one of their primary advantages. They can detect electrical impulses produced by the brain by inserting electrodes inside the earphones. Users are able to monitor their mental state, degree of attention, and even amount of stress throughout the day thanks to this real-time monitoring, which offers insights into brainwave patterns.

Activity Level Monitoring.
Keeping an eye on physical activity.
These cutting-edge earphones can efficiently measure workout levels in addition to brain activity. Data on physical motions and cardiovascular activity are provided by built-in accelerometers and heart rate sensors. Users may keep track of their workouts using this data to make sure they are on track and reaching their fitness objectives.
